Quick question: Can stereo CD players play DVDs with mp3s?
My stereo deck in my truck has a CD player. On the front panel it says mp3 and wav or some other audio format. If I put mp3 files on a DVD RW can I play music on it, or will the stereo deck ONLY play CDs?
I ask because I have some blank DVD RWs but no CD RWs to put music on. The local radio stations are shit and I'd like to have some decent music for driving.

>>51693780
CD players can not read DVD's. Purchase blank CD's and burn a data disc with mp3's in the format your player supports.
